Story summary
- Leslie Buckner, director of rehabilitation at Methodist Hospitals in Chicago, helped a coma patient communicate with pen and paper.
- The patient later achieved full recovery after regaining communication.
- She prioritizes health equity for uninsured patients.
- She earned a PT degree from Marquette University through the Health Careers Opportunity Program.
- Former chair Dr. Lawrence Pan helped her family feel welcomed.
